The Thule Enroute Camera Backpack 25L in black is designed for hikers who need to carry and protect their camera gear. With its 25-liter capacity, it offers sufficient space for your DSLR or mirrorless camera along with lenses and other accessories, thanks to its adjustable dividers inspired by origami.
The backpack weighs about 3.04 pounds, which is relatively light, making it easier to carry during long hikes. Comfort and fit are enhanced with padded shoulder straps and back panel, which help distribute weight evenly and reduce strain. Durability is a strong point, as Thule is known for using high-quality materials that withstand tough conditions, making this backpack a reliable choice for outdoor use.
Accessibility is another highlight, with side zippered entry allowing quick access to your camera without having to dig through the entire bag. The backpack also features a separate padded compartment for a laptop up to 15.6 inches and a tablet up to 10.5 inches, making it versatile for those who need to carry additional electronics. The magnetic roll-top closure allows you to adjust the pack's size based on your load, providing flexibility.

The f-stop Loka Ultra-Light 37L Camera Pack Bundle is a solid choice for photography enthusiasts who enjoy hiking. With a total capacity of 37 liters, it offers enough space to carry your essential gear and camera equipment. The included Slope Medium Internal Camera Unit (ICU) is specifically designed to accommodate a gripped DSLR or mirrorless kit, including a telephoto lens up to 70-200mm, which is great for those who need to bring along substantial photography gear on their hikes.
The bundle also includes a rain cover, which is a nice touch for weather protection. Weighing just 2.25 pounds when empty, the pack is relatively lightweight, which is important for long hikes. The internal aluminum frame and adjustable support system provide good all-day comfort and support, though the fit might not be perfect for everyone due to the specific torso length of 13.5 inches.
The material is durable, but the bag's design means it might not be suitable for carrying larger items beyond the camera equipment. Additionally, while the pack is form-fitting, some users might find it a bit too snug or minimalistic depending on their load. This camera backpack could benefit hikers and outdoor photographers looking for a lightweight and durable pack with decent weather protection and specialized compartments for camera gear.

The f-stop Shinn 80L Bundle is a large-capacity camera backpack designed for outdoor photographers and cinematographers who need to carry a substantial amount of gear. With an 80-liter capacity, it can hold multiple cameras, lenses, and accessories, making it suitable for extended hiking trips where professional equipment is required. It weighs around 15 pounds, which is on the heavier side even before adding gear, so it might feel bulky for some users, especially on long hikes.
f-stop backpacks are known for durable materials and solid construction, providing good protection for your gear in rough outdoor conditions. Accessibility and organization are enhanced by the included Cine Master ICU, a customizable insert that helps keep camera equipment neatly organized and easy to reach.
This backpack is well-suited for serious hikers and outdoor filmmakers who need lots of space and organization, though its weight and size might be a drawback for those seeking a lighter, more compact option.
